ThinBlueLine05 wrote:After playing a series of extremely frustrating ranked matches and losing about half my BP, I've decided that I'm going to mod my arcade stick. I'm better with the 360 controller and I've figured out why:
1. The SE stick has a ball top which I've never been fond of, I much more prefer the bat top sticks.
2. The un-godly square gate. Oh how I hate this piece of shit. While trying to do a QCF I always get stuck in one of the damn corners.
To remedy this situation I'm going to switch out the ball top for a Sanwa LB-30-N Joystick Bat Top ( I'll have to get the adapter as well). I'm also going to put a Sanwa GT-Y Octagonal Restrictor Plate in there. I'm also considering switching out the buttons with some translucent Seimitsu PS-14-KN 30mm Pushbuttons.
Overall this is only going to cost me around $15. The bat top and restrictor plate are $4.95 each and the adapter is only $0.50. Not too bad. I just wish they had translucent bat tops because I really like the look of the Seimitsu bubble tops. I might get one of those too just to see which I like more. The best part about these mods is that there's no soldering required, everything just snaps or screws into place which is a good thing because with my luck, I'd probably end up setting my crotch on fire.
